I have a battery operated set of ear muffs for working at the shop. They have a built in amplifier so with them on I can actually hear better. When there is a noise frequency spike they auto dampen the noise. Keeps me from yelling when they are on my head and removes the need to take them off or occupy a hand to lift one side for conversation. I can hear the radio in the shop better even with background noise present. Not sure exactly how they work but they work well. I think they were about $60 at Praxair where I buy my welding supplies

Buzkin,
As a Motorola Dealer, I actually sell Peltor headsets and here in Canada so I can tell you that model runs around $200.

They have a minimum setting for the ambient noise level so you can always hear around you.

We sold a factory a bunch of them to solve the "getto blaster wars".

We sell alot of the WorkTunes model front our store which doesn't have ambient noise but makes cutting the lawn much more enjoyable and quiet.
